DIAZ DE ARCE, REV. LUIS. The Rev. Luis Oscar Díaz de Arce was born July 11, 1917 in Cárdenas, Cuba to Bernardo Díaz de Arce and Mercedes Trenzado. He died on June 10, 2012, in Hialeah, Florida. He was a minister of the Methodist Church in Cuba, serving as pastor, district superintendent and...
